Afternoon punk and indie bursts
The Chats — 3 p.m., Gobi Tent
The Australian punk trio headlines an early slot at the Gobi Tent. Their breakout track “Smoko” arrived eight years ago.
They have released two EPs and two studio albums since. Their 2022 LP “Get F—” followed a noisier 2020 work.
Gigi Perez — 4 p.m., Outdoor Theatre
The South Florida singer-songwriter found viral fame on TikTok with “Sailor Song” in 2024. Her 2025 debut album is titled “At the Beach, In Every Life.”
After Coachella she joins Noah Kahan on stadium dates. Expect intimate, emotive performances.
Jane Remover — 4:20 p.m., Sonora Tent
Jane Remover’s 2025 LP “Revengeseekerz” blends hyperpop textures and punk intensity. The record feels blown-out and meticulously arranged.
The live set promises a maximal emotional sweep. It is an act to watch for adventurous listeners.
Wet Leg — 4:45 p.m., Coachella Stage
Wet Leg returns with a 2025 sophomore album, “Moisturizer.” Their self-titled debut earned major critical praise and two Grammys.
Rhian Teasdale’s stage presence drives sing-along moments. Songs like “mangetout,” “CPR,” and “jennifer’s body” are fan favorites.
Late afternoon to early evening heavy hitters
Clipse — 5:15 p.m., Outdoor Theatre
The Virginia Beach duo of Pusha-T and Malice staged a surprise comeback in 2025. “Let God Sort Em Out” arrived 16 years after their previous release.
Their return brought awards recognition, including a Grammy and Album of the Year nomination. Their set mixes classics and recent tracks.
Suicidal Tendencies — 5:35 p.m., Mojave Tent
The Venice-born band channels SoCal punk and metal energy. Frontman Mike Muir leads a group still active after more than four decades.
Expect aggressive riffs and an anti-authoritarian bite. Their performance revisits the band’s 1980s roots.
Less Than Jake — 5:45 p.m., Heineken House
Less Than Jake brings ska-punk cheer to a festival crowd. They retain Warped Tour DNA and party-ready singalongs.
Standards like “All My Best Friends are Metalheads” and “History of a Boring Town” remain staples. Fans also expect lively stage antics.
Sunday night centerpiece
Iggy Pop — 7:10 p.m., Mojave Tent
The proto-punk icon returns to the festival for a prime-time slot. He delivers timeless songs such as “I Wanna Be Your Dog,” “The Passenger,” and “Lust For Life.”
